The string "72d5e021..." is likely an MD5 or SHA-1 hash used to uniquely identify a file in a database.

Be cautious with files named with long random strings from unknown sources, as they can sometimes be used to mask malicious content or phishing attempts.

The filename appears to be a hashed or system-generated name rather than a widely recognized viral video title . These types of alphanumeric strings are commonly produced by servers, content delivery networks (CDNs), or messaging apps like WhatsApp or Discord during the upload process.
